Olhepat Population - Latehar, Jharkhand

Olhepat is a medium size village located in Balumath Block of Latehar district, Jharkhand with total 144 families residing. The Olhepat village has population of 806 of which 414 are males while 392 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Olhepat village population of children with age 0-6 is 156 which makes up 19.35 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Olhepat village is 947 which is lower than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Olhepat as per census is 950, higher than Jharkhand average of 948.

Olhepat village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Olhepat village was 62.00 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Olhepat Male literacy stands at 70.96 % while female literacy rate was 52.53 %.

Caste Factor

In Olhepat village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C) &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 47.02 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 45.78 % of total population in Olhepat village.

Work Profile

In Olhepat village out of total population, 289 were engaged in work activities. 65.40 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 34.60 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 289 workers engaged in Main Work, 78 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 89 were Agricultural labourer.
